APPLICATION OF SIMMOD-BASED SIMULATION: CONSULTANTS/AIRPORT OPERATORS' PERSPECTIVE. MONTREAL DORVAL (YUL) CASE STUDY

Abstract:

This presentation offers a review of SIMMOD studies for Montreal Dorval Airport, discussing the simulation input needs and output results. Since 1997, all simulation studies at Montreal Dorval Airport have been conducted using LeTech's version of the SIMMOD model. The presentation also offers a brief review of capacity definitions for practical and theoretical capacity. Also presented are data for Montreal Dorval Airport on aircraft classification, runway occupancy times, landing and takeoff roll distances, aircraft speed, unloading and boarding times, push back and power up times, reaction delays to air traffic control actions, and deicing times.
